Komatsu (OTCMKTS:KMTUY) Releases FY 2026 Earnings Guidance

Komatsu (OTCMKTS:KMTUYGet Free Report) issued an update on its FY 2026 earnings guidance on Wednesday. The company provided EPS guidance of 2.450-2.450 for the period, compared to the consensus earnings per share estimate of 2.500. The company issued revenue guidance of $27.0 billion-$27.0 billion, compared to the consensus revenue estimate of 0.000.

Komatsu Price Performance

Shares of Komatsu stock opened at $44.84 on Friday. The company has a current ratio of 2.11, a quick ratio of 1.19 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.18. The firm has a fifty day simple moving average of $40.65 and a 200-day simple moving average of $41.86. The stock has a market capitalization of $41.72 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 16.43, a PEG ratio of 2.61 and a beta of 1.05. Komatsu has a 1-year low of $30.65 and a 1-year high of $52.74.

Komatsu (OTCMKTS:KMTUYGet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Wednesday, July 29th. The industrial products company reported $0.67 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.59 by $0.08. The firm had revenue of $6.37 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$6.13 billion. Komatsu had a net margin of 8.93% and a return on equity of 10.49%. Komatsu has set its FY 2026 guidance at 2.450-2.450 EPS. On average, sell-side analysts expect that Komatsu will post 2.39 earnings per share for the current year.

Komatsu Ltd. (OTCMKTS: KMTUY) is a Japanese multinational manufacturer of construction, mining and industrial equipment. Founded in the early 20th century in Komatsu, Ishikawa Prefecture, the company has grown into a global supplier of heavy machinery and related services for industries including construction, mining, forestry and infrastructure development.

Komatsu’s product lineup covers a broad range of mobile and stationary equipment, including hydraulic excavators, bulldozers, wheel loaders, rigid and articulated dump trucks, dozers, compact equipment, and specialized mining machines for both surface and underground operations.
